The finding allows DOI’s Bureau of Ocean Energy Management (BOEM) to move forward with its process for considering the Wind Energy Area (WEA) lease sales.

The WEAs, which total approximately 307,590 acres (1,245sq km) include Kitty Hawk (about 122,405 acres), Wilmington West (about 51,595 acres) and Wilmington East WEA (about 133,590 acres).

“After considering public input and conducting a thorough environmental review, we believe that wind leasing and site characterization activities can be done in a manner that will continue to allow for other uses, and be compatible with the environment,” says BOEM Director Abigail Ross Hopper.
